Constructor Detail
-
UnaryExpression
public UnaryExpression(UnaryExpression.Operator op, Expression argument)
Create a new unary expression.- Parameters:
-
op
- Operator new expression. -
argument
- Operand of new expression. - Since:
- 43.00
-
-
Method Detail
-
getOp
public UnaryExpression.Operator getOp()
-
getArgument
public Expression getArgument()
-
evaluate
public double evaluate(double[] solution)
Compute the value of this expression with respect to the given solution vector (which is not required to be feasible).- Specified by:
-
evaluate
in classExpression
- Parameters:
-
solution
- Solution values for which the expression is evaluated. - Returns:
-
The value of this expression evaluated at
solution
. - Since:
- 43.00
